Synopsis
Canceled 2012 Japanese-Korean horror film about four time-manipulating characters preventing high school tragedies; only 6-minute promo remains.
The Japanese-Korean horror movie should have been released in 2012, but the project got canceled after Korean investors could not be determined. A six-minute promotional video is what's left of it of this attempted co-production. Timing holds the story of four characters with abilities related with time, fighting to stop the tragedies occurring in a high school. (Source: Hancinema)
